为什么64位Win7选择“禁用驱动程序强制签名”后仍然会警告?

为什么64位Win7选择“禁用驱动程序强制签名”后仍然会警告?

我有一个必须在 64 位 Windows 7 上运行的测试驱动程序。

根据 MSDN,有两种方法可以禁用操作系统检查驱动程序的数字签名:

方法1.将机器连接到调试器,例如WinDBG;

方法 2. 在启动机器时,按 F8 并选择“禁用驱动程序签名强制执行”。

我使用方法 2 启动操作系统,并加载测试驱动程序;但是,加载驱动程序时,弹出一个消息框,警告我该驱动程序未经签名,无法运行。我忽略了它,我的测试驱动程序按预期运行。

我的问题是:

  1. 为什么在禁用驱动程序签名强制时会弹出消息框?

  2. 如何防止消息框弹出?

相关内容